    Family Therapy

    I believe that what happens to one member of a family happens to the entire family. A family operates like a seesaw: When one or more members are hurting or struggling, the whole family system falls out of balance.

    I counsel families around a variety of mental health issues that can strain family relationships, including depression; anxiety; trauma; addiction; grief and loss; coping with illness; divorce; behavioral and conduct issues; poor boundaries; bullying; adjustment and life transitions; assisting a family member in crisis; medical concerns; and caregiver support.

    Focusing on individual and group strengths, I partner with parents and families to help resolve their conflicts by exploring, identifying, and changing unhealthy patterns of communication. The family works together to better understand the group dynamics—how their individual roles affect each other and the family unit as a whole. The goal is to restore healthy relationships by providing family members with insights and tools to support each other.

    Some positive family therapy outcomes are:

    • Identifying strategies to develop and maintain boundaries
    • Improving communication among family members
    • Fostering a sense of cohesion in the family
    • Promoting problem-solving through an understanding of family patterns and dynamics
    • Building empathy and compassion
    • Reducing family conflict
